Kirsty, you do have to draw a line in the sand. But the hard part is over in a matter of 30-60 days, and then you find that these foods are not so compelling. Then you stop regarding them as even being food.

The problem is when you don't draw the line in the sand. Then you always think of things like chocolate or cake as things you MIGHT eat just a little. Then those foods start to occupy your thoughts.

A good tip when you are trying to change is this. When the thought of a SAD treat first enters your mind, have a knee jerk reaction to do something else that will occupy yourself. I might practice my trombone or read a book. Anything to get your mind off the thought of the treat. If you sit there and have a long debate with yourself over whether or not to eat the treat, you may well eat it.
